Javascript 为什么我的Jquery工具提示不起作用?

Javascript 为什么我的Jquery工具提示不起作用?,javascript,jquery,jquery-selectors,Javascript,Jquery,Jquery Selectors,我没有得到一个工具提示来工作,我想问题是我的选择器。 我选择了一个位于此处的插件: 它表示可以使用元素的title属性作为选择器。我想选择菜单项,并附加一个工具提示,以描述每一个菜单链接。似乎最简单的方法就是使用title属性。我只需要在每个工具提示中放入大约10个或更少的单词。在描述可能出现的问题之前,让我先提几件事 我在页面上也有一个JQuery手风琴,来自jqueryui.com网站。到jqueryui的链接放在从调用jquery工具之后。起初我以为这是jqueryui,但jqueryui

我没有得到一个工具提示来工作,我想问题是我的选择器。 我选择了一个位于此处的插件: 它表示可以使用元素的title属性作为选择器。我想选择菜单项,并附加一个工具提示,以描述每一个菜单链接。似乎最简单的方法就是使用title属性。我只需要在每个工具提示中放入大约10个或更少的单词。在描述可能出现的问题之前,让我先提几件事

我在页面上也有一个JQuery手风琴,来自jqueryui.com网站。到jqueryui的链接放在从调用jquery工具之后。起初我以为这是jqueryui,但jqueryui没有工具提示——虽然它们有一个类似的对话框,但我不需要标题,只需要几个字

那么,让我们看看我可能会错在哪里。 对jquery工具的调用在对jqueryui的调用之前。当这被颠倒过来时,我的手风琴坏了

插件文档说有一个class.tooltip默认可用,代码还允许我将工具提示的类设置为tooltip。它肯定没有得到我为工具提示设置的任何样式。我不知道如何确认这个工具提示类是否存在,因为它只在工具提示出现时显示

C我的选择器。起初,我尝试了CSS子体选择器,就像我在CSS中一样。我甚至添加了一个id为tooltip的包含div

1第一个选择器:$工具提示a[title],以获取具有title属性的a标记。文档中描述了这一点,但对我来说,似乎您希望在锚定标记上触发,而不是它的title属性 使用后代选择器$.art Humenu a.tt[title]进行2秒尝试-我在具有art Humenu类的标记内有一个具有类tt的锚标记,我想要title属性。-没用。 3最后,我尝试使用工具提示。查找'a[title]'-认为这样可以找到具有title属性的锚标记。 文档页面说明此代码将利用元素的title属性: $img[title]。工具提示; 这可能会在每个img标签上都有一个工具提示,不是吗?我上面的第一个例子类似于使用工具提示a:[标题],但它不起作用。 也许标题不应该出现在锚标签上,而应该出现在li标签上。 我需要一些帮助来解决这个问题——不管问题出在哪里,我想这就是我的选择。 谢谢
Bruce

您正在查找属性,因此请改用$'tooltip a'。attrtitle

听起来你把事情复杂化了。
给链接、短语、输入、按钮、触发器类和标题。工具可以处理其他一切。可以使用.tooltip类设置工具提示的样式。使用“偏移”和“位置”设置定位工具提示。如果你想疯狂地使用样式,你可以布局:或者打开插件源代码,并将html包装在附录标题周围。

我知道这并不能回答你的问题,但我刚刚研究了一系列不同的工具提示库-看看QTip2-它似乎是最好的一个。好吧,QTip2确实对我有用。我只需选择锚定标记,它就获得了文本在工具提示中显示的标题属性值。我将尝试一下。谢谢。那好像不管用。这是我的脚本,我在网站底部的结束体标签上方。jQuerydocument.readyfunction{tooltip a.attrtitle.tooltip{position:右上角,tipClass:tooltip};};